Ok, I am currently a senior and have gone to few dental school interviews so far and I will find out next week if I get accepted. I was told by my recruiter that she can NOT submit my application without me having my bachelor's degree. I was supposed to graduate after this fall semester but I needed to drop a class(non-prereq) and finish in the spring of 2014 instead. So now I could only hope that there will some scholarships left in may when I get my degree.

does anyone have any experience with this? I feel like it doesn't make sense that they can't give me a conditional acceptance. Also, don't students usually graduate in the may? so we have to graduate early or take a semester off in order to be early for the scholarship? this is strange...

Members don't see this ad.
 
You have to be in line to graduate in order to submit your application...but no you do not have to already have your bachelors. I applied last spring, and wasn't set up to get my degree until summer 2013. It all worked out, I think that I had to get a letter from my advisor or dean stating that I will be graduating July 2013, before dental school starts.

do you know when do they usually notify people who get the 4 year scholarships?
There is a board meeting every month in which students are selected for the scholarship that have their packet completed. I don't know what month the board meetings begin to happen (do a search). The results are given to your recruiter monthly. The last month for a board meeting this past year (for the 4 year scholarship) I believe was in April. Everything from there out was OML'd for the 3 year scholarship, in which the board meetings for that begins October every year.
